Control rooms set up, minimal disruption in power supply expected: Divisional Commissioner Kashmir

Srinagar: Divisional Commissioner Kashmir on Friday said that control rooms have been set up in every district and all concerned departments have been asked to ensure facilities are provided uninterrupted to people across the Valley.
Talking to INS, Divisional Commissioner Kashmir Baseer Ahmad Khan said that concerned Deputy Commissioners has been asked to ensure that the action plan for restoration of basic services and supplies is implemented in synergy and coordination with all the line departments on real time basis for which control rooms at the district and sub district headquarters be kept functional 24×7.
He said district administration has kept men and machinery ready to meet any eventuality on account of inclement weather. He said that adequate number of snow clearance machines and bulldozers have been deployed at specific locations across the division besides water supply tankers.
Regarding power, he said that PDD has said that this time minimal disruption in power supply is expected due to snowfall. “The major disruption in power supply due to snow fall of November 3 and 4 was mainly because of foliage on trees. Moreover, adequate buffer stock of transformers is available in all districts” he said.
